Colorado State’s Nique Clifford named to All-Mountain West first, defensive teams

Nique Clifford leads a trio of Colorado players who were named to this year’s Mountain West all-conference men’s basketball teams.

The 6-foot-6 senior guard, who starred at The Vanguard School in Colorado Springs, was named to the all-defensive team and was an all-conference first-team selection. He led the Rams in points (18.4 per game), rebounds (9.4) and assists (4.4), leading them to a 22-9 regular-season record (16-4 in the MW). It’s his second all-conference selection as he received third-team honors last season.

Air Force senior guard Ethan Taylor made the third team after leading the Falcons in points (13.6), rebounds (5.4), assists (3.5) and steals (1.5).

Wyoming senior guard Obi Agbim — who starred at Rangeview High School, Fort Lewis College and Metro State before joining the Cowboys — was also a third-team selection and named the Mountain West newcomer of the year. Agbim averaged a team-high 17.8 points and 3.5 assists.

Colorado State sophomore guard Kyan Evans was named an honorable mention.

Player of the Year: Donovan Dent, Jr., G, New Mexico

Defensive Player of the Year: Magoon Gwath, R-Fr., F, San Diego State

Newcomer of the Year: Obi Agbim, Sr., G, Wyoming

Sixth Man of the Year: Javan Buchanan, Jr., F, Boise State

Freshman of the Year: Magoon Gwath, R-Fr., F, San Diego State

Steve Fisher Coach of the Year: Richard Pitino, New Mexico
